在微信小程序中,如何利用已有的豆瓣电影API集成实现Top250电影列表展示及电影详情的获取与展示?
时间: 2024-11-23 19:37:02 浏览: 15
要实现微信小程序中的豆瓣电影Top250功能并展示电影详情,首先需要了解微信小程序的基本架构和配置方法。接着,利用豆瓣API获取电影数据,需要处理网络请求和数据解析。以下是详细的技术实现方法和步骤:
参考资源链接:[微信小程序实战:豆瓣电影API集成与功能实现](https://wenku.csdn.net/doc/6zyeis7t7t?spm=1055.2569.3001.10343)
1. **项目构架和配置**:
- 在微信小程序中创建四个主要页面:城市热播榜页面、豆瓣电影Top250列表页、搜索页和电影详情页。
- 在项目的 app.json 中定义各个页面的路径和配置信息,设置全局导航栏和tabBar的样式和功能。
2. **API调用与数据获取**:
- 使用 wx.request 方法发起网络请求,获取豆瓣电影Top250的JSON数据。
- 对获取的数据进行解析,提取出电影名称、评分、简介等关键信息,并展示在列表页上。
- 当用户点击列表中的某部电影时,通过传递的电影ID,发起新的API请求获取该电影的详细信息,并跳转到电影详情页进行展示。
3. **电影详情展示**:
- 在电影详情页中,利用解析的数据构建页面布局,展示电影的详细信息,包括海报、导演、演员、剧情简介等内容。
- 可以使用微信小程序提供的组件如 image、view、text 等来设计和展示界面。
4. **轮播图实现**:
- 利用微信小程序的 Swiper 组件实现轮播图功能,可以加载电影海报作为轮播图的内容。
5. **源码和调试**:
- 可以参考提供的源码下载链接,对照源码来检查和调试自己的代码实现。
- 使用微信开发者工具进行代码调试,确保所有功能正常运行,数据正确加载。
通过以上步骤,即可在微信小程序中实现豆瓣电影Top250的展示和电影详情的获取与展示。这个过程不仅涉及到前端的数据展示和用户界面的设计,还包括后端的数据获取和处理。为了更深入地了解整个项目的构建过程,强烈建议参考《微信小程序实战:豆瓣电影API集成与功能实现》这篇博客,它提供了从项目构架到功能实现的完整过程,对于希望掌握微信小程序开发的开发者来说,将是一个极好的学习资源。
参考资源链接:[微信小程序实战:豆瓣电影API集成与功能实现](https://wenku.csdn.net/doc/6zyeis7t7t?spm=1055.2569.3001.10343)
阅读全文